Arboretum Hamilton, Bermuda

Arboretum

Montpellier Road, Devonshire Parish , (off Middle Road)

Hamilton, Bermuda

One of Bermuda's largest green areas, this park consists of 22 acres of open space. It boasts an excellent collection of ornamental and fan palms, ficus, ebony and poinciana trees. Poincianas blossom in a scarlet blaze and are particularly beautiful when they are in full bloom from June to September. A gazebo and an ornamental pond can also be found further into the park.
